> ehmm Dieter 'invented' the eurorack standard..

Not really. The format of the front panels, frames and cases was an industry
standard a long time ago (e.g. used by Schroff). But in this standard all pc
boards were 100x160 mm (so-called Euro format) and a very expensive 64 pin
bus connector and bus board was used (only the bus board was ~ Euro 150). We
changed to a simpler bus board (the A-100 bus) and replaced the fixed pcb
format by a free format combined with a flexible ribbon cable for bus
connection.

>>What system was it built for?
> As far as I remember it was compatible to the Formant system (DIY synth
> project by the magazine Elektor).
Yepp. The Formant used 3HE for LFOs ADSR, Noise, VCA, and other modules 
and 6HE for the VCOs and VCFs (6HE is the double height standard of the 
euro rack system). Dieter also had an envelope follower, which I still 
use today. I also had the triple phaser, but somewhen I started to 
plunder it for ICs I needed for another project.
